Hey — quick handover before I'm out. The Crumbline bakery cutoff rule now closes orders at 14:00 local, not midnight UTC, so the nightly job may look like it's skipping orders. It isn't. If a shop complains about missing same-day orders, check their timezone config first. Anything weirder than that, ping the person named below.

named custodian: Brivan Eliath Quenox Frador

## Releases

Cut releases only when the Quillbrook read-replica lag alarm is green. If lag exceeds threshold, the migration step will time out and roll back dirty. Tag, build, run `relcheck`, then deploy. Do not silence the alarm to force a release; fix replication first. All release artifacts must be signed. Sign with the maintainer key shown below.

signing key of bagap-yawep = bky13_TbfT6ZMUoGJo2

### Changed defaults — Scrubbit EXIF pipeline

Heads up for the sync: Scrubbit now strips GPS and serial-number tags by default instead of opt-in. Marnie flagged too many uploads slipping through with location data, so we flipped it. Orientation tags are still preserved so thumbnails don't rotate weirdly. Existing deployments pick this up on restart with these defaults applied.

service settings:
[casax]
port = 6379
team = rusir
host = casax.zemvarhq.corp
region = outer-4
access_code = ac_9808ce
timeout_ms = 1500